Radiator Cooling Fan Control Module: Service and Repair

COOLING FAN ECU

COMPONENTS:





REMOVAL
1. DISCONNECT CABLE FROM NEGATIVE BATTERY TERMINAL

CAUTION: Wait at least 90 seconds after disconnecting the cable from the negative (-) battery terminal to prevent airbag and seat belt pretensioner activation.

2. REMOVE COOL AIR INTAKE DUCT SEAL
3. REMOVE NO. 1 AIR CLEANER INLET
4. REMOVE COOLING FAN ECU
(a) Disconnect the 3 connectors from the ECU.
(b) Remove the 2 screws and ECU from the fan shroud.

INSTALLATION
1. INSTALL COOLING FAN ECU
(a) Install the ECU to the fan shroud with the 2 screws.
Torque: 2.5 N*m (25 kgf*cm, 22 in.*lbf)
(b) Connect the 3 connectors to the ECU.

2. INSTALL NO. 1 AIR CLEANER INLET
3. INSTALL COOL AIR INTAKE DUCT SEAL
4. CONNECT CABLE TO NEGATIVE BATTERY TERMINAL
5. PERFORM INITIALIZATION
(a) Perform initialization.

NOTICE: Certain systems need to be initialized after disconnecting and reconnecting the cable from the negative (-) battery terminal.
